Mitchell replaces Marais as head coach at Blue Bulls

John Mitchell - Blue Bulls

John Mitchell has taken over as the coach of the Blue Bulls for the remainder of the Currie Cup.


Nollis Marais was placed on special leave following the teams’ 41-40 defeat to the Toyota Free State Cheetahs on Saturday at Loftus Versfeld.

The Cheetahs winger Makazole Mapimpi scored his hat-trick in the 85th minute to see the defending champions move back to the top of the standings.

Following that defeat, Marais, said the problems at the Bulls is not an attitude thing.

“It’s not an attitude thing, it’s a system thing and guys also making individual errors.

“We’ve got some young guys getting into the swing of things in the Currie Cup. So far we’ve had fifteen debuts.

“It no so much a system thing, but the individual errors we’re making is putting us under a lot of pressure.”

Barend van Graan, CEO of the Blue Bulls Company, explained that this action is merely the next step in the turnaround strategy.

“We are working hard to ensure the sustainable and long-term success of the Bulls and Blue Bulls, as we continue striving towards achieving success and restoring trust and faith in our brand.”

He added that the Mitchell’s appointed at head coach will allow for their structures to develop.

“I believe this step furthermore grants us the opportunity to cross pollinate within our structures, ensuring what coaches have learnt whilst being involved at senior rugby levels is transferred throughout the entire system and structure, thus benefiting at all levels."

Mitchell’s first game in charge will be against the Pumas on Friday evening in Nelspruit.
